Invention Grant
- Patent Title: Method of, and a device for updating a multiple-processing entity packet management system, and associated computer program product
-
Application No.: US14306602Application Date: 2014-06-17
-
Publication No.: US10412046B2Publication Date: 2019-09-10
- Inventor: Avishay Moscovici , Michal Silbermintz
- Applicant: Avishay Moscovici , Michal Silbermintz
- Applicant Address: US TX Austin
- Assignee: NXP USA, Inc.
- Current Assignee: NXP USA, Inc.
- Current Assignee Address: US TX Austin
- Main IPC: H04L29/06
- IPC: H04L29/06 ; G06F16/16 ; G06F16/2458 ; G06F16/21 ; H04L12/755 ; H04L12/715 ; H04L12/741

Abstract:
There is described a method of managing a flow of data packets in a multiple-processing entity system comprising a plurality of look-up tables adapted to store information associated to actions to be performed on packets received by the system. The method comprises storing, on a per entry basis, in a shadowed entry associated to any table entry being updated, the previous content of said table entry being updated, in association with a table entry version number, for use for managing packets received in the system prior to any update operation. It is thus possible to continue using look-up tables while updating process is being carried out for some or all of the table entries. The solution provides benefits for systems that are limited in space and cost, by use of minimal memory thanks to the storing of small shadowed data instead of full shadowed table.
Public/Granted literature
Information query